Xi Jinping presided over the closing session.

More than 2,300 delegates and specially invited delegates are expected to pass resolutions on the report of the 18th CPC Central Committee, a work report
of the CCDI and an amendment to the CPC Constitution.


At least 8 percent of nominees for candidates for members and alternate members of the 19th Central Committee of the CPC and candidates for members of
the CCDI have been voted off in preliminary elections in the past days.


Discussions of 34 delegations on the report to the 19th CPC National Congress, delivered by Xi on behalf of the 18th CPC Central Committee at the
opening of the congress, were open to journalists at designated periods of time.


More than 3,000 journalists covered the congress. Among them, 1,818 are from overseas including Hong Kong, Macao and Taiwan, 6.7 percent more than the 18th
CPC National Congress. Foreign reporters come from 134 countries, 19.6 percent
more than the previous congress.


The five-yearly congress, which opened on Oct. 18, was held during the decisive stage when China is building a moderately prosperous society in all
respects and at a critical moment as socialism with Chinese characteristics has
entered a new era.


The CPC has more than 89 million members.

BEIJING, Nov. 16 (Xinhua) -- On the morning of Oct. 18, Xi Jinping, standing behind a lectern in the Great Hall of the People, delivered a report to the 19th
National Congress of the Communist Party of China (CPC).


The 32,000-character report, the most significant of its kind in recent decades, drew more than 70 rounds of applause from delegates.


In the report, Xi said socialism with Chinese characteristics had crossed the threshold into a new era.


"This is a new historic juncture in China's development," he stated.

The report has been translated into 10 foreign languages. Most of the translators and foreign linguists involved used the word "powerful" to describe
their first impressions.


"I was absorbed the first time I read it. I read from morning till midnight, even forgetting to have meals," said linguist Olga Migunova from Russia.


U.S. expert on China studies and chairman of the Kuhn Foundation, Robert Lawrence Kuhn, said that with this political report and the congress, Xi, who is
the core of the CPC Central Committee and of the whole Party, sees China as
standing at a new historic starting point.


At the first plenary session of the 19th CPC Central Committee on Oct. 25, Xi was re-elected general secretary of the CPC Central Committee for a second term,
a reflection of the will of the entire CPC. Media and observers, at home and
abroad, see Xi as the right man to lead China from being "better-off" into a
great modern country.


In 1949, Mao Zedong announced the founding of the People's Republic of China, marking the end to a century of humiliation at the hands of foreign aggressors.


Deng Xiaoping, who put forward the reform and opening-up policy, then paved the way for the nation to become rich.


The coming five years between the 19th and the 20th Party Congress is the period in which the timeframes of the Two Centenary Goals will converge, Xi said
when presenting the new CPC central leadership to the press.


"Not only must we deliver the first centenary goal, we must also embark on the journey toward the second," he said, promising to work diligently to "meet
our duty, fulfill our mission and be worthy of CPC members' trust."


He stressed that Chinese Communists "must always have a youthful spirit, and forever be the servants of the people, the vanguard of the times and the
backbone of our nation."
